Manju Rani (born 26 October 1999) is an Indian Boxing. She won a silver medal at the 2019 AIBA Women's World Boxing Championships. She also won a silver medal at the Strandja Memorial Boxing Tournament 2019 held in Bulgaria and bronze medals at the Thailand Open 2017 and India Open 2017.
Background
Rani hails from Rithal Phogat village in the
Rohtak district of
Haryana. Her father was a Border Security Force officer who died of cancer in 2010.
The Rani had initially started playing
kabaddi, but her coach advised her to switch to boxing. Inspired by Indian boxer
Mary Kom's bronze-winning performance at the 2012 London Summer Olympics, Rani made a shift to boxing.
Sports
Rani won a
silver medal at the Strandja Memorial Boxing Tournament 2019,
Bulgaria in 48 kg category after losing finals against
Josie Gabuco of
Philippines.
She also won a
silver medal at the 2019 AIBA Women's World Boxing Championships after losing
Light flyweight final to Russia's Ekaterina Paltceva.
In 2019 Rani signed up with sports management firm Infinity Optimal Solutions (IOS) which will handle her endorsements and commercial interests. In November 2020, Rani served a notice of termination of contract on IOS Sports and Entertainment for not fulfilling the sponsorship deal.
